How is the phrase meter la pata translated from Spanish to English
Hacer un estropicio con algo; informal.
To make a mess of something; informal.

See how the word “meter la pata” is used in sentences
No vuelvas a meter la pata. — Do not screw things up again.
Sabe muy bien cómo estropearlo todo en el trabajo. — He really knows how to screw things up at work.
Siempre meto la pata cuando estoy nervioso. — I always screw things up when I'm nervous.
¿Has vuelto a estropearlo todo con la presentación? — Did you screw things up again with the presentation?
Un clic mal dado y metes la pata del todo. — One wrong click and you screw things up completely.
Por favor, no lo estropees todo esta vez. — Please don’t screw things up this time.
